Idaho Code § 62-303 — Crossings Not On State Highways — Elimination Or Alteration.

TITLE 62 RAILROADS AND OTHER PUBLIC UTILITIES CHAPTER 3 RAILROAD CROSSINGS ON HIGHWAYS 62-303. Crossings not on state highways — Elimination or alteration. Whenever a highway not a state highway crosses one or more railroads, the local authorities in their respective jurisdictions, or railroad company or companies, shall have the same authority and perform the same duties with respect to the elimination or alteration of such crossing as are granted to and required of the Idaho transportation department and railroad company or companies by this chapter.

History:[(62-303) 1929, ch. 151, sec. 3, p. 274; I.C.A., sec. 60-303; am. 1967, ch. 11, sec. 3, p. 17; am. 1974, ch. 12, sec. 91, p. 61.]
